bin/arch still reports messages in list language/charset

Bug #1768892 reported by Yasuhito FUTATSUKI at POEM
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
GNU Mailman
Low
Mark Sapiro

Bug Description

When mm_cfg.DISABLE_COMMAND_LOCALE_CSET is false, bin/arch try to use locale environment variables to determin which language/charset to use for output messages, but only help message is affected by command line locale, progression messages are still reported in lists language/charset.

These messages are in Mailman/Archiver/HyperArch.py and Mailman/Archiver/pipermail.py, using Mailman.Archiver.HyperArch.HyperArchive.message() to output to stderr (only if VERBOSE flag is set).
The patch attached fixes these message to use i18n.C_() instead of i18n._().

Related branches

Revision history for this message
Yasuhito FUTATSUKI at POEM (futatuki) wrote :
Revision history for this message
Mark Sapiro (msapiro) wrote :

Thanks for the fix.

Changed in mailman:
assignee: nobody → Mark Sapiro (msapiro)
importance: Undecided → Low
milestone: none → 2.1.27
status: New → Fix Committed
Mark Sapiro (msapiro)
Changed in mailman: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ers